K**M
Not for classroom use
I bought several of these tents to use for my dramatic play area for my in-home preschool. I only have six students at a time so I thought they would be cute to add. Unfortunately this seams are very loose and break open easily. Because of the amount of use that I would want to get out of them over the years I decided to return them as they are not worth 30 to $50 each, which is what I paid for them. If I was only using them for one or two children in my own home, I would say they're very cute and I would go for it!
